Transaction 51074b33b205bb7517367c1a16f0b27113f9a5208712baeb16a6528d4cf4573a

19 Input
2 Outputs
  • 51074b33b205bb7517367c1a16f0b27113f9a5208712baeb16a6528d4cf4573a:0
  • value  557636391
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 51074b33b205bb7517367c1a16f0b27113f9a5208712baeb16a6528d4cf4573a:1
  • value  711498
    address  1PBa5ppwcMmXg3R7T9or5ZTbURgYAxTH9r